About this property
Refurbished Coach House in rural setting.
The Coach House is a self-contained building with ample parking at the end of a no-through road and surrounded by the Grade I Waddesdon Estate. Waddesdon Manor (NT) is in walking distance, Bicester Village is within easy reach and walks abound.
The open-plan ground floor has spacious seating and dining and kitchen areas. The cosy beamed attic contains the bedroom, landing-com-study/dressing area and wet room/bathroom.
Sleeps two upstairs in the bedroom.
The space
The self-contained and private Coach House is great for a romantic weekend, staycations or a working-from-home alternative with the 30MB+ WiFi broadband with dedicated desk and working area.
When you need a break, there’s miles of beautiful country walks from right outside the front door.
Full electric underfloor heating throughout and sunny outdoor seating area.
Newly converted with wooden floors and sparkling clean with an enhance COVID sanitation regime between guests with particular attention to frequently touched areas.
Fibre broadband, WiFi, Apple TV, washer/drier, fridge/freezer, coffee machine etc and an outside seating are as shown in the photos.
Guest access
You will have full run of the self-contained Coach House with sitting room, fully equipped kitchen, dining area downstairs and a wet room shower room bathroom, working space and bedroom.
There’s even a sunny sitting are right outside the door. We’ll even find you a private area within the 1.5 acre garden, orchard, wood or open area.
Other things to note
The Coach House is perfect for a romantic escape, a visit to Bicester Village, Waddesdon Manor & their wine tastings and other events as well as a convenient place to stay if you are invited to an event at the Waddesdon Dairy. It's also a great working from home change of scene with the fast broadband.
With the station just 3 miles away, you can even fit in a trip to London.
Bring your bike as there is an excellent safe cycle path with pub at the end or hire one of the electric bikes in the Waddesdon Manor car park - just a short walk away and £1.50 for the first hour and 50p/hr thereafter.
